ConGreSS profILe

Since its launch in 2010, COPHy is establishing itself as a unique educational meeting where physicians can meet with outstanding experts in major Ophthalmology fields, and be updated on the most pressing clinical questions of the day. COPHy is the only annual congress of its kind that focuses mainly on controversial issues.

aImS of the ConGreSS

To provide the insights into major changes in the rapidly evolving field of Ophthalmology. •

To provide an effective forum for discussing and debating unsolved issues by allowing ample • time for speakers/audience discussion.

To promulgate ethics and standards of practice and treatment•

To bridge gaps between expansion of basic science and information, and their consolidation • into clinical practice

To make it possible for the industry to meet the outstanding experts in the field, and to • update international participants on pressing clinical and technological questions of the day.

MediCal retina

age-related macular degeneration: drug of choice

Aflibercept (Eylea)• Bevacizumab (Avastin) • Ranibizumab (Lucentis)•

age-related macular degeneration: Frequency of treatment

PRN (e.g., as needed or treat and extend)• Fixed frequency (e.g., monthly or every other • month)First year vs subsequent years•

Behcet’s disease treatmentImmunosuppression?• Which biological agents?• Local versus systemic therapy?•

Choroidal imaging: is it necessary for diagnosis, prognosis, or treatment?

Central serous chorioretinopathy: ManagementFocal leak: Prompt vs deferred laser treatment• Chronic diffuse leak: Observation? PDT full • fluence? PDT half fluence?

diabetic macular edema: drug of choice and treatment regimen with center-involved edema and vision impairment in phakic patients

Anti-VEGF with deferred or prompt laser?• Aflibercept, bevacizumab, or ranibizumab?• Monthly or DRCR Network algorithm or other • algorithmLaser followed by anti-VEGF?•

dMe – treatment regimen in pseudophakic patients

Anti-VEGF• Corticosteroids•

Endophthalmitis prevention in intravitreal injections

Topical antibiotics? – Before? After? Both?• Sterile gloves and drapes?•

autofluorescence: is it necessary for diagnosis, prognosis, or treatment management

laser in dMeNon-center-invovled DME?• Standard or subthreshold?• Center-involved DME with excellent visual acuity • (e.g., 20/20): Observe?Laser? Laser followed by anti-VEGF? Anti-VEGF?•

dietary supplements for age-related macular degeneration

Intermediate stage of AMD?• Early stage of AMD?• Family history and no AMD or only early stage of • AMD?Lutein or zeaxanthin?• Cigarette smokers?• Gel caps or tablets?• Role in geographic atrophy?•

Multifocal erg: is it necessary for diagnosis, prognosis, or treatment management

pseudophakic cystoid macular edemaTopical NSAIDs (which one?), topical • corticosteroids (which one?), or both?Role of subTenon’s or intraocular corticosteroids•

retinal vein occlusion with macular edemaPrompt treatment or observe for spontaneous • improvementCorticosteroids or anti-VEGF in phakic patients• Cortiosteroids or anti-VEGF in pseudophakic • patients

retinopathy of prematurity: initiate treatment with anti-VegF therapy or laser

treatment of uveitis-related cystoid macular edema

Intravitreal corticosteroids• SubTenon’s corticosteroids• Anti-VEGF therapy• Systemic immunosuppressive agents•
